Understanding Pharmacovigilance and Its Growing Importance

Pharmacovigilance (PV) involves the detection, assessment, understanding, and prevention of adverse effects or any other drug-related problems. It is a continuous process that extends throughout the lifecycle of a product—from clinical trials to post-marketing surveillance.

Today’s pharmaceutical companies are expected to handle mountains of safety data, submit timely regulatory reports, and ensure effective ICSR case processing (Individual Case Safety Reports). For many, this level of responsibility demands expertise, resources, and infrastructure that exceed their internal capacity.

Why Companies Turn to Pharmacovigilance Consulting Services

Access to Specialized Expertise

Hiring a pharmacovigilance consulting firm gives companies immediate access to professionals with years of experience in regulatory compliance, signal detection, case management, and risk minimization planning. These experts understand local and global regulations—like FDA, EMA, and MHRA standards—and stay ahead of regulatory updates so you don’t have to.

Scalable Support

Consulting services allow pharmaceutical companies to scale pharmacovigilance operations up or down based on project demands, clinical trial phases, or post-market activities. This is particularly valuable for smaller biotechs or startups that don’t yet have a full in-house PV team.

Efficient ICSR Case Processing

One of the most resource-intensive tasks in pharmacovigilance is ICSR case processing, which includes collecting, reviewing, coding, and submitting adverse event reports. Consultants streamline this process using industry best practices and automated systems, significantly reducing the margin for error.

The Financial Impact: Measuring the ROI

Reduced Compliance Risk

Non-compliance can result in warnings, fines, or even product withdrawal. Quality pharmacovigilance consulting services help you stay compliant with ever-evolving regulations, minimizing your exposure to legal and financial consequences. Avoiding just one major compliance issue can justify the investment in expert support.

Cost Savings on Talent and Technology

Building and training an in-house PV team can be expensive—not to mention the costs of safety databases, software licenses, and continuous education. By outsourcing to consultants, companies reduce long-term operational costs while still accessing the latest technology and top-tier professionals.

Faster Time to Market

Consultants can improve regulatory readiness by accelerating safety data analysis, clinical report submissions, and audits. This enables your product to progress through the approval pipeline more quickly and enter the market sooner—leading to earlier revenue generation.

Strategic Decision-Making

Beyond compliance, consultants often provide valuable insights into benefit-risk profiles, helping you make smarter decisions on product lifecycle management. This strategic input enhances product value, improves market confidence, and boosts shareholder trust.
